Nusantara 5 (Nusantara Lima)

Nusantara 5 [Boeing]

Nusantara 5 or Nusantara Lima, is an Indonesian geostationary HTS (high throughput satellite) communications satellite built by Boeing.

The satellite was built on Boeing's BSS-702MP bus, likely the modified cancelled GiSAT 1 satellite. It has a capacity exceeding 160 Gbps, which will provide primary service in Indonesia and some ASEAN countries. The spacecraft will complement the SATRIA-1 satellite and provide back-up for it in case the main satellite were to experience an outage or fail to meet capacity.

In October 2023 the operator announced, the decision to terminate the HBS contract became necessary due to limited financial resources in completing the national digital inclusion target.

Nation: Indonesia
Type / Application: Communication
Operator: PT Pasifik Satelit Nusantara
Contractors: Boeing
Equipment:
Configuration: BSS-702MP
Propulsion: ?, electric propulsion
Power: 2 deployable solar arrays, batteries
Lifetime: 15 years
Mass:
Orbit: GEO
